#34751f - RGB(52, 117, 31) - Forest Green Color FAQ

What is the color code for Forest Green?

Hex color code for Forest Green color is #34751f. RGB color code for forest green color is rgb(52, 117, 31).

What is the RGB value of #34751f?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#34751f is rgb(52, 117, 31).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'52' indicates the intensity of the red component, '117' represents the green component's intensity, and '31'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#34751f.

What does RGB 52,117,31 mean?

The RGB color 52, 117, 31 represents a dull and muted shade of Green. The websafe version of this color is hex 336633.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Forest Green.
